Smith was held to five points (1-5 FG, 0-3 3Pt, 3-4 FT) to go with three assists, two rebounds and two steals across 27 minutes in Tuesday’s 115-84 Game 1 win over the Raptors.

After averaging 14.8 points and 4.7 three-pointers in the Cavs’ first six games of the postseason, Smith has dropped out of the limelight in the past three games. While Tuesday’s blowout had a significant impact on his lessened workload, Smith is still shooting just 30.8 percent from the field over that three-game stretch. He’ll likely get hot again eventually, but as a player whose fantasy value almost entirely rests on his three-point shooting, Smith’s production should be volatile throughout the rest of the playoffs.
